Christian Audigier Has Purchased Neverland RanchPosted on: September 4, 2009 | Comments Off
Perfect. Creepy Ed Hardy designer Christian Audigier has purchased Michael Jackson’s creepy Neverland Ranch. Audigier will be turning the $90 million Holmby Hills, California estate into his company’s headquarters, but he has other plans for Neverland into a haven for fans of the King of Pop. “I can have the house in one month now,” Audigier revealed Thursday. “I get the keys two weeks from today.” In an interview with Agence France-Presse Thursday, Audigier said: “I bought the Michael Jackson house. It’s something I’m gonna open just for the birthday (sic) of his death every June, where the media is gonna be able to come in and we’ll do exposes, etc.” Audigier had been developing a clothing line with Michael Jackson prior to his anesthesia-induced death last June and most sources report they had a good relationship. “Ed Hardy” Creator Slams Victoria Beckham’s LinePosted on: July 6, 2009 | Comments Off
Oh if this isn’t just the pot calling the kettle black. The brilliant mind behind the classy and elegant brands Von Dutch and Ed Hardy, Christian Audigier, has slammed Victoria Beckham and her high-end clothing line. “I like her, she is a nice girl, but she is not completely my style. I have seen some of her designs- they are very simple. It’s difficult for an artist or a singer to enter into the world of fashion,” Audigier explains. “You can’t just rely on your name to help you sell. The way to sell and who to sell to and what you want to accomplish, these are all things you will need help with if you’re entering into the world.” I find this hilarious coming from the man who is responsible for the creating the $150 white trash tshirt and the trucker hat.
